Moldova Faces Massive Russian Disinformation Campaign Ahead Parliamentary Elections
Moldova is facing intense Russian interference ahead of its pivotal parliamentary elections, with Russia deploying hundreds of millions of euros, cryptocurrency, and sophisticated disinformation campaigns to sway voters toward pro-Russian parties. President Maia Sandu and other officials warn that Moscow aims to halt Moldova's westward integration and install a government more aligned with Russia, using tactics including vote-buying, online propaganda, and recruiting provocateurs to sow disorder. Russian disinformation efforts include AI-generated content on social media platforms like TikTok, Instagram, Telegram, and the spreading of false narratives about European military threats to the breakaway region of Transnistria to justify potential Russian incursions. Despite Moldovan authorities blocking Kremlin-linked television channels, propaganda continues to flood online spaces with coordinated campaigns involving bots and fake accounts, reaching around one million subscribers on Telegram alone. High-level warnings from European and Ukrainian leaders emphasize the election's significance for regional stability, framing Moldova's EU trajectory as critical for peace and security in the area. The scale and sophistication of Russian interference are described as unprecedented, aiming not only to influence the election outcome but also to destabilize Moldova and the wider region.
